Building & Safety
The Building and Safety Division is responsible for establishing and enforcing minimum building standards for the purpose of protecting the health, safety, and general welfare of those who live, work, shop and play in Los Alamitos.

Code Enforcement
The Code Enforcement Division responds to complaints of violations of the Los Alamitos Municipal Code that include substandard buildings, property maintenance, inoperative vehicles, weed abatement and land use violations.

Planning
The Planning Division's responsibilities include customer service related to physical development, Planning Commission work program implementation, Zoning Code development and administration, General Plan formulation and implementation, implementation of California Environmental Quality Act mandates, compliance monitoring for regional, state, and federal laws and, development review.

Public Works & Engineering
The Public Works Department is responsible for the maintenance of the City's infrastructure, including City streets, roadway signage, and landscaping, performing graffiti abatement for public facilities, managing drainage structures, performing upkeep of City parks, and overseeing the maintenance of City-owned traffic signals.

Report A Problem / Submit A Service Request
The My Los Al mobile app and web portal enables service requests (potholes, noise complaints, dangerous conditions, graffiti, etc.) to be submitted directly to the City, where they will be instantly routed to the correct administrator in the appropriate department. This means service requests will be responded to quickly and efficiently, and residents will be notified the instant problems are resolved. The app is also a great source of information on City services and news.
